Pain Points in Manual Invoicing
Manual invoicing processes are prone to delays, data entry errors, and compliance risks due to their reliance on human input and fragmented communication channels. Traditional methods often lead to invoice mismatches, duplicate payments, and extended payment cycles, which can strain vendor relationships and disrupt cash flow [13]. For instance, SMBs face challenges in tracking approvals and reconciling discrepancies without integrated systems, increasing the likelihood of late fees or overpayments [11]. Additionally, manual data entry consumes significant employee time—up to 30% of accounting staff’s hours in some cases—diverting focus from value-added activities [7]. These limitations highlight the need for automated solutions that ensure consistency, transparency, and compliance with financial regulations.

AI-Powered Cash Application
AI-powered cash application uses machine learning to automate the reconciliation of payments with invoices, reducing manual intervention in matching transactions. For example, systems like Invoiced employ AI to analyze payment data against open invoices, automatically resolving complex cases such as partial payments or multi-invoice settlements [9]. This feature is particularly valuable in reducing errors and accelerating accounts receivable processes, with studies showing up to 70% reduction in manual workloads [11]. Platforms like BILL further integrate AI to detect anomalies in payment patterns, flagging potential fraud or discrepancies for review [4]. However, implementation may require initial customization to align with specific accounting rules, and small businesses might find the setup costs prohibitive compared to simpler solutions [13].

Automated Collections and Dunning
Automated collections and dunning workflows reduce the need for manual follow-ups by triggering pre-set actions based on payment statuses. BILL’s platform, for instance, sends tiered email reminders, adjusts payment plans for delinquent accounts, and escalates cases to collections if necessary, all without human intervention [4]. Invoiced’s AR automation further incorporates AI to predict payment likelihood and recommend optimal dunning strategies, improving recovery rates by up to 40% [9]. These systems also integrate with CRM tools to update customer records in real time, ensuring teams have accurate data for communication [15]. While automation reduces administrative burdens, over-reliance on rigid workflows may lead to poor customer experiences if exceptions aren’t manually reviewed [13].

QuickBooks
QuickBooks offers invoice automation tailored for small to mid-sized businesses, enabling features like customizable invoice templates, payment reminders, and multi-currency support [1][3]. Its cloud-based architecture allows real-time access and collaboration, while third-party app integrations (e.g., Shopify, Square) enhance functionality [3]. However, advanced AP automation capabilities—such as three-way matching—are limited compared to specialized tools [1]. Users praise its intuitive interface but may seek additional modules for complex financial workflows [3]. Security and Compliance
Security remains a critical consideration, particularly for handling sensitive financial data. BILL’s platform [4] explicitly mentions encryption protocols and compliance with financial regulations, which are essential for safeguarding vendor and customer information. Solutions leveraging robotic process automation (RPA), as described in [12], integrate audit trails and role-based access controls to meet compliance standards like GDPR or SOC 2. Stripe’s overview [7] further emphasizes secure cloud environments, though organizations must verify that vendors provide regular security updates and penetration testing. Compliance challenges arise when automating cross-border payments, requiring software to adapt to regional data privacy laws. [13] warns that insufficient encryption or outdated compliance frameworks can expose businesses to legal risks, underscoring the need for rigorous vendor due diligence. Real-World Applications and Case Studies
Real-world applications of invoice automation software demonstrate its transformative impact across industries. SoftCo, a provider of digital procurement solutions, implemented its procure-to-pay (P2P) software to streamline eProcurement and accounts payable (AP) processes for clients [2]. By automating invoice validation, three-way matching, and payment workflows, SoftCo reduced manual data entry errors by 40% and accelerated processing times from days to hours. A manufacturing client using SoftCo’s P2P platform reported a 25% reduction in AP operational costs within six months, attributed to automated supplier onboarding and exception handling [2]. Challenges included initial resistance from finance teams accustomed to legacy systems, resolved through phased training programs and iterative software customization [2].
Another case study from the PDF “Integrated Invoicing Solution: A Robotic Process Automation (RPA) Application” [12] highlights an unnamed healthcare provider adopting RPA for invoice preprocessing. The system utilized optical character recognition (OCR) and machine learning to extract data from invoices, aligning it with purchase orders and inventory records. This reduced invoice processing time by 60% and cut discrepancies by 35% [12]. However, the organization faced data quality issues due to inconsistent supplier formatting, requiring manual intervention for 15% of invoices. The study emphasized the importance of supplier collaboration to standardize documentation, a lesson applicable to other enterprises [12]. Streamline Workflows and Approval Processes
Efficient workflows minimize delays by automating repetitive tasks and enforcing structured approval chains. Gartner reviews stress that advanced AP applications, such as Medius, embed global payment capabilities and multi-currency support to simplify cross-border transactions [2]. See the [Top Invoice Automation Software Solutions] section for more details on Medius and other platforms offering these features. Meanwhile, SMB automation tools often use tiered approval workflows, where invoices are routed to designated managers based on predefined thresholds [13]. For example, a $5,000 threshold might trigger a dual-approval process, ensuring compliance with financial policies. Key features include optical character recognition (OCR) for rapid data extraction and SLA tracking to monitor processing times. However, overly complex workflows can create bottlenecks if not regularly audited [12].

### Robotic Process Automation (RPA) for Invoicing
RPA is emerging as a critical tool for automating repetitive tasks in invoice processing. A 2023 case study on integrated invoicing solutions demonstrated how RPA, combined with machine learning, can preprocess invoices by extracting key fields like vendor names, line items, and tax details [12]. This preprocessing step significantly reduces the need for manual data entry, cutting processing times by 40–50% in some deployments. PyTorch-based models, mentioned in the same study, are being used to improve the accuracy of optical character recognition (OCR) systems, enabling better handling of handwritten or poorly formatted documents. Despite its benefits, RPA implementation often requires customization to align with existing workflows and may face resistance in organizations with legacy systems. Additionally, while RPA excels at rule-based tasks, it currently lacks the contextual understanding of complex exceptions, which still require human oversight [12].
